We had a great stay at the Pendry West Hollywood. The service was excellent and very accommodating from start to finish. Our room was spotless with beautiful decor, and the shower water pressure was perfect—always a plus! The entire staff was warm and welcoming, and the location was ideal. We also appreciated how transparent the hotel was about in-room items and charges—no surprises or hidden fees. Special shoutout to the room cleaning lady—she was absolutely the best. So friendly and attentive, and our room was always perfectly refreshed. The on-site restaurant was fantastic—great service, incredible food, and stunning views. The only drawbacks were the valet-only parking at $70/day and the limited flexibility with the Chase Luxury Hotel Collection perks. We received a $30 breakfast credit per person, but with breakfast prices, we ended up spending well over $60 total and had to pay the difference. We also couldn’t apply our $100 hotel credit toward valet or the remainder of our breakfast bill. It would’ve been nice to have more ways to use that credit, especially since we didn’t dine at the hotel for lunch or dinner. Overall, we really enjoyed our experience and would definitely return—just hoping for a bit more flexibility with credits next time.
